Pudina Puri

Brief Description
Here's a delicious puri recipe with some pudina in it. Now we will learn how to prepare pudina mint puri.
Total Preparation Time 15 minutes Total Cooking Time 10 minutes Servings 4 Ingredients of Pudina Puri
- Wheat Flour (Gehun Ka Atta)- 250 gm
- Fresh Mint (Pudina) -1/2 cup
- Add Salt Acording to Taste
- Use Clarified Butter for Frying
How to make Pudina Puri
- Wash and properly grind the pudina.
- Now mix salt, pudina, atta and 1 tbsp of ghee.
- Now knead it to prepare into hard dough.
- Prepare some small balls from the dough and then roll them into small puris.
- Start heating the ghee in a pan.
- Now fry each puri in ghee.
- Cook one side completely first and then turn it to other till it becomes light brown.
- Puris are prepared and are ready to serve hot.
Some Useful Tips
These Poories do not puff up like balloons like regular ones because of the minced Mint leaves and spices which are present in the dough but they do taste good!
